Learn How to Crush with a Fork: Opening Tactics
This puzzle comes from the Polish Opening and shows a classic middlegame tactical refutation. Black’s pieces are active, White’s king is still in the center, and the position contains a vulnerable bishop and weak squares around the king. The key idea is a crushing fork: a knight jump that creates check while also attacking important material targets. In practical classical chess, these motifs often decide games before the endgame even begins.
